About Network Assets APIs
The Kentik V5 Admin APIs offer "network assets" APIs for programmatically managing settings in the Admin section of the Kentik portal, including the following:
Devices and interfaces: Managed via the Device API, offering similar functionality to the portal’s Device Settings Dialog.
Device labels: Managed via the Device Label API, provides functionality equivalent to the portal’s Labels Page.

Device JSON
Device API calls return an HTTP response with a JSON device object, or, an array of such objects for the Device List call. The object contains the fields (name/value pairs) shown in the following example:
{
"device": {
"id": "9623",
"company_id": "1289",
"device_name": "pd_router",
"device_subtype": "router",
"device_description": "test of device settings",
"plan_id": 123,
"site_id": 394,
"device_flow_type": "netflow.v5",
"device_sample_rate": "1024",
"sending_ips": [
"142.254.47.216"
],
"device_snmp_ip": "142.254.47.216",
"device_snmp_community": "",
"minimize_snmp": false,
"device_bgp_type": "device",
"device_bgp_neighbor_ip": "142.254.47.216",
"device_bgp_neighbor_asn": "5001",
"device_bgp_password": null,
"use_bgp_device_id": null,
"custom_columns": null,
"created_date": "2016-09-09T17:27:18.080Z",
"updated_date": "2016-09-09T17:27:18.080Z"
"device_snmp_v3_conf": {
"UserName": "eenie",
"AuthenticationProtocol": "MD5",
"AuthenticationPassphrase": "meenie",
"PrivacyProtocol": "DES",
"PrivacyPassphrase": "minie"
},
}
}
Each device object contains fields with information about an individual device registered in Kentik to your organization. These fields are detailed in the following tables.
Device Object
JSON name | Type | Description |
---|---|---|
id | number | The system-assigned device ID. |
company_id | number | The system-assigned ID of the company (organization). |
device_name | string | User-supplied device name. |
device_subtype | string | The subtype of the device, see Device Subtypes. |
device_description | string | User-supplied device description. |
plan_id | number | The ID of the plan to which this device is assigned. Available plans can be found via the Plans API.
|
site_id | number | The system-assigned ID of the site, if any, to which this device is assigned. |
device_flow_type | string | For routers, the flow type sent to Kentik (NetFlow v5, NetFlow v9, sFlow, or IPFIX). For hosts, it’s IPFIX, the flow type sent from the Kentik nProbe host agent.
|
device_sample_rate | string | Total packets transiting the device for each packet processed for flow data (see Flow Sampling). |
sending_ips | array of strings | IPs from which the device will send flow to Kentik. |
device_snmp_ip | string | The IP address for polling the device (router). |
device_snmp_community | string | The SNMP community for polling the device (router). |
minimize_snmp | boolean |
|
device_bgp_type | string | Reserved for internal use. |
device_bgp_neighbor_ip | string | BGP Neighbor IP |
device_bgp_neighbor_asn | string | BGP Neighbor ASN (16- or 32-bit) |
device_bgp_password | string | BGP Password |
use_bgp_device_id | string | Use this device's BGP table instead of creating a new BGP session. |
custom_columns | N.A. | Internal use only. |
created_date | string | Date-time of registration of the device in Kentik creation, in UTC (ISO 8601), e.g., 2015-01-27T01:39:17.186Z |
updated_date | string | Date-time of last edit to the device in UTC, e.g., 2015-01-27T01:39:17.186Z |
device_snmp_v3_conf | object |

Setting device_snmp_v3_conf
The device_snmp_v3_conf
object is included in request JSON to use SNMP V3 for router polling. If omitted, Kentik will assume SNMP V3 is intended.
Parameter | Type | Description |
---|---|---|
UserName | string | The username for SNMP v3 authentication.
|
AuthenticationProtocol | string | SNMP v3 authentication protocol.
|
AuthenticationPassphrase | string | Password for SNMP V3 authentication.
|
PrivacyProtocol | string | The SNMP V3 privacy type:
|
PrivacyPassphrase | string | Password for SNMP V3 privacy.
|
Note: SNMP V3 authentication and privacy settings are independent. To disable both, set AuthenticationProtocol to NoAuth and PrivacyProtocol to NoPriv.

Device Apply Labels
The Device Apply Labels PUT method removes all existing labels (see Labels) from the specified device and applies the specified new labels.
Notes:
If no labels are specified, this method will still remove all existing labels from the specified device.
To create and manage device labels via API, see Device Label API.
HTTP Request
The following table shows the path and HTTP request for this call:
URL | api.kentik.com/api/v5/devices/device_id/labels |
Request | POST /api/v5/devices/device_id/labels HTTP/1.1 |
Note:
If your organization is registered on Kentik's EU cluster, use
api.kentik.eu
in place ofapi.kentik.com
in the URL above.
The following parameters are passed in a JSON object in the request body:
Parameter | Type | Description |
---|---|---|
labels | array | An array of id objects.
|
id | integer | The id of a label to apply to the device. |
The example below shows a request body for adding two labels to a device.
{
"labels": [
{
"id": 1096
},
{
"id": 32
}
]
}
HTTP Response
A successful response from the Device Apply Labels method includes the following elements:
Response headers
HTTP response code
A single JSON device object with a labels array showing the labels assigned to the device post-operation. An example of a successful label application is provided below.
{
"id": "device_id",
"device_name": "device_name",
"labels": [
{
"id": label_id,
"name": "label_name",
"edate": "2019-03-07T00:53:51.759Z",
"cdate": "2019-03-07T00:53:51.759Z",
"user_id": "#####",
"company_id": "####",
"color": "#800000",
}
]
}
Note: For details on the JSON name/value pairs in an individual labels object, see Device Label Object.

Interface JSON
The interface methods of the Device API return an HTTP response body with an "interface" JSON object (or an array of objects for the Interface List call). The object includes name/value pairs as shown in the following example:
{
"id": "9201304925",
"company_id": "1289",
"device_id": "2951",
"snmp_id": "150",
"snmp_speed": "1000",
"snmp_type": 6,
"snmp_type": 53,
"snmp_alias": "irs",
"interface_ip": "198.186.192.33",
"interface_description": "Vlan350",
"interface_kvs": "\"updated\"=>\"1\"",
"interface_tags": "",
"interface_status": "V",
"cdate": "2017-04-19T00:40:01.145Z",
"edate": "2017-05-03T03:20:27.303Z",
"initial_snmp_id": "150",
"initial_snmp_alias": "irs",
"initial_interface_description": "Vlan350",
"initial_snmp_speed": "1000",
"interface_ip_netmask": "255.255.255.224",
"secondary_ips": [
{
"address": "198.186.193.51",
"netmask": "255.255.255.240"
}
],
"connectivity_type": "",
"network_boundary": "",
"initial_connectivity_type": "",
"initial_network_boundary": ""
"top_nexthop_asns": null,
"provider":"",
"initial_provider": "",
"vrf_id": ####
"vrf": {
"name" : "test_vrf",
"description" : "This is still a test",
"route_distinguisher" : "11.121.111.13:3254",
"ext_route_distinguisher" : 296507164417724,
"route_target" : "101:100"
}
}
Each interface object contains fields with information about an individual interface on a Kentik-registered device. These fields are described in the following tables.
Note: For details on the settings represented by the name/value pairs (see Interfaces Page).
Interface Object
An interface
object contains all the information about an individual interface of a device registered with Kentik.
JSON name | Type | Description |
---|---|---|
id | string | The system-assigned ID of the interface. |
Company_id | string | The system-assigned ID of the customer. |
Device_id | string | The system-assigned ID of the device to which this interface belongs. |
Snmp_id | string | The interface index (ifIndex) as defined in the device and retrieved via SNMP. Same as initial_snmp_id unless manually overridden when device is created or updated in Kentik. |
Snmp_speed | number | The capacity of the interface in Mbps. Same as initial_snmp_speed unless manually overridden when device is created or updated in Kentik. |
Snmp_type | integer | Reserved for internal use. |
Snmp_alias | string | User-specified text used by Kentik as the description of the interface. Same as initial_interface_description unless manually overridden when device is created or updated in Kentik. |
Interface_ip | string | The IP address assigned to the interface. |
Interface_description | string | User-specified text used by Kentik as the name of the interface. Same as initial_snmp_alias unless manually overridden when device is created or updated in Kentik. |
Interface_kvs | number | Reserved for internal use. |
Interface_tags | number | Reserved for internal use. |
Interface_status |
| Reserved for internal use. |
Cdate | string | Date-time of registration of the interface in Kentik creation, in UTC (ISO 8601), e.g. 2015-01-27T01:39:17.186Z |
edate | string | Date-time of last edit to the interface, in UTC, e.g. 2015-01-27T01:39:17.186Z |
initial_snmp_id | string | Last SNMP-polled SNMP ID of the interface on its device. |
Initial_snmp_alias | string | Last SNMP-polled interface description. |
Initial_interface_description | string | Last SNMP-polled interface name. |
initial_snmp_speed | string | Last SNMP-polled interface capacity (Mbps). |
Interface_ip_netmask | string | The netmask configured for the interface (applies to Ipv4 interfaces only). |
Secondary_ips | array | See secondary_ips Array. |
Connectivity_type | string | Reserved for internal use. |
Network_boundary | string | Reserved for internal use. |
Initial_connectivity_type | string | Same as connectivity_type. |
Initial_network_boundary | string | Same as network_boundary. |
Top_nexthop_asns | array | An array of ASNs, see Top Next Hop ASNs. |
Provider | object | The provider, as determined by provider classification, via which traffic from a given externally facing interface reaches the Internet; see Provider Classification. |
initial_provider | string | Reserved for internal use. |
vrf_id | string | If the interface is assigned to a VRF, the ID of that VRF, otherwise null. |
vrf | string | Present only if the interface is assigned to a VRF; see VRF Attributes. |
secondary_ips Array
The secondary_ips
array contains one or more objects, each specifying a secondary IP address for the interface.
JSON name | Type | Description |
---|---|---|
address | string | A secondary IP for the interface. |
netmask | string | The netmask configured for this secondary interface_ip (applies to IPv4 interfaces only). |
Top Next Hop ASNs
An array of objects showing ASNs that received the most packets from the interface in the past hour.
JSON name | Type | Description |
---|---|---|
ASN | number | The AS number. |
packets | number | The number of packets in the hour preceding the call. |
VRF Attributes
The vrf
object, present only if the interface is assigned to a VRF, consists of elements corresponding to each VRF attribute:
Parameter | Type | Description |
---|---|---|
name | string | Name of the VRF entry. |
description | string | Description of the VRF entry. |
route_target | string | Route Target Community of the VRF entry. |
route_distinguisher | string | Route Distinguisher of the VRF entry. |
ext_route_distinguisher | integer | External Route Distinguisher of the VRF entry. |

Interface Update
The Interface Update PUT
method modifies system data for a specific interface, identified by ID, within the specified device's existing interfaces.
HTTP Request
The following table shows the path and HTTP request for this call:
URL | https://api.kentik.com/api/v5/device/device_id/interface/interface_id |
Request | PUT /api/v5/device/device_id/interface/interface_id HTTP/1.1 |
Notes:
The “interface_id” in the path corresponds to the “id” in each interface object from the Interface List array.
If your organization is registered on Kentik's EU cluster, use api.kentik.eu in place of api.kentik.com in the URL above
When updating an interface, the JSON object must include the required snmp_id and any fields to be updated (see table under HTTP Request in Interface Create). The following example shows an update to the interface’s description:
{
"snmp_id": "150"
"interface_description": "This is a truly great interface."
}

Device Label JSON
Calls to the Device Label API return an HTTP response body with a JSON device label object, or an array of such objects for the Device Label List call. The object includes fields (name/value pairs) as shown in the following example:
{
"id": 32,
"name": "ISP",
"color": "#f1d5b9",
"user_id": "#####",
"company_id": "####",
"order": 0,
"devices": [
{
"id": "#####",
"device_name": "my_device_1",
"device_subtype": "router"
},
],
"created_date": "2018-05-16T20:21:10.406Z",
"updated_date": "2018-05-16T20:21:10.406Z"
}
Each device label object contains fields with information about an individual device label. These fields are described in the following tables.
Note: For details of the settings represented by these name/value pairs, see Labels.
Device Label Object
JSON name | Type | Description |
---|---|---|
id | number | The system-assigned ID of the device label. |
name | string | User-specified text of the device label (e.g. "ISP"). |
color | string | The color, in hex, associated with this device label (e.g., "#f1d5b9"). |
user_id | string | The ID of the user who created or last edited the label. |
company_id | string | The system-assigned ID of the customer in which the label exists. |
devices | array | |
created_date | string | Date-time in UTC (ISO 8601) at which the device label was created (e.g., 2015-01-27T01:39:17.186Z). |
updated_date | string | Date-time at which the label was most-recently edited. |
Devices Array for Labels
An array of device
objects, each containing a subset of elements from the full device
object (see Device JSON), represents devices associated with labels. The table below lists the included elements.
JSON name | Type | Description |
---|---|---|
id | string | The system-assigned ID of the device. |
device_name | string | Name specified by user when device was last edited. |
device_subtype | string | See Device Subtypes. |

Device Label Update
The Device Label Update PUT
method modifies data for a specified device label by ID in your organization's collection.
HTTP Request
The following table shows the path and HTTP request for this call:
URL | api.kentik.com/api/v5/deviceLabels/label_id |
Request | PUT /api/v5/deviceLabels/label_id HTTP/1.1 |
Notes:
The "label_id" in the path corresponds to the “id” in the
device_label
object from the Device Label List array.If your organization is registered on Kentik's EU cluster, use
api.kentik.eu
in place ofapi.kentik.com
in the URL above.
The parameters to be changed are passed in a JSON device label object:
To update the label's name, include the
name
field only.To update the label's color, include both the
name
andcolor
fields.
Example of a device label object to update the color to dark blue:
{
"name": "Edge"
"color": "#000080"
}
